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

A soil wetting agent is shown and described herein. The soil wetting agent comprises (a) a siloxane alkoxylate; (b) a polymeric dispersant; (c) a pH adjuster; (d) a sugar; and (e) a carrier resin. The soil wetting agent can provide improved distribution of water and/or bioactive materials or nutrients to an area of soil, which can help to improve irrigation of the area as well as improved properties of the crops grown in the area in terms of germination, crop yield, crop size, etc.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

What is claimed is: 1 . A soil wetting agent comprising: (a) a siloxane alkoxylate; (b) a polymeric dispersant; (c) a pH adjuster; (d) a sugar; and (e) a carrier resin. 2 . The soil wetting agent of claim 1 , wherein the siloxane alkoxylate (a) is selected from a compound of the formula (I): M 1 D 1 x D 2 y M 2   (I) where: M 1 =(R 1 )(R 2 )(R 3 )SiO 0.5 M 2 =(R 4 )(R 5 )(R 6 )SiO 0.5 D 1 =(R 7 )(R 8 )SiO D 2 =(R 9 )(R 10 )SiO x is an integer of from about 0 to about 50; y is an integer of from about 1 to about 15; R 1 , R 2 , R 3 , R 4 , R 5 , R 7 , R 8 , and R 10 are each independently selected from a monovalent hydrocarbon radical having from 1-4 carbon atoms; R 6 is R 11 or Z, and R 9 is R 11 or Z, where at least one of R 6 or R 9 is Z; R 11 is a monovalent hydrocarbon radical having from 1-4 carbon atoms; Z is a polyalkyleneoxide group of the general formula: R 12 —O—[C 2 H 4 Oπ a —[C 3 H 6 Oπ b —[C 4 H 8 Oπ c —R 13 , where R 12 is a linear or branched divalent hydrocarbon group of 3 to 4 carbon atoms, R 13 is selected from the group consisting of H or monovalent hydrocarbon radicals of from 1 to 6 carbon atoms and acetyl, a is 2 to 20, b is 0 to 30, and c is 0 to 10, with the provisos that 4≤a+b+c≤45, and a≥4; and when b+c=0, then a=5-12. 3 . The soil wetting agent of claim 1 , wherein the siloxane alkoxylate (a) is present in an amount of from about 5 wt. % to about 60 wt. %; the polymeric dispersant (b) is present in an amount of from about 1 wt. % to about 10 wt. %; the pH adjuster (c) is present in an amount of from about 0.1 wt. % to about 5 wt. %; the sugar component (d) is present in an amount of from about 5 wt. % to about 15 wt. %; and the resin carrier is present in an amount of from about 20 wt. % to about 50 wt. % based on the weight of the soil wetting agent composition. 4 . The soil wetting agent of claim 1 , wherein x is 0; y is 1-15; R 1 , R 2 , R 3 , R 4 , R 5 , R 6 , R 7 , R 8 , and R 10 are each independently methyl, ethyl, propyl, or butyl; R 9 is Z; R 12 is a divalent hydrocarbon with 3-4 carbon atoms; a is 4-15; b is 0-25; c is 0; and R 13 is hydrogen or methyl. 5 . The soil wetting agent of claim 1 , wherein the soil wetting agent is a powder. 6 . The soil wetting agent of claim 1 , wherein the polymeric dispersant is selected from an anionic polyacrylate carboxylate copolymer, an anionic styrene acrylic acid copolymer, an anionic alkylnaphthalene sulfonate condensate polymer, a sodium alkyl naphthalene sulfonate, a polyvinyl pyrrolidone copolymers, or a combination of two or more thereof. 7 . The soil wetting composition of claim 1 , wherein the pH adjuster is selected from a carboxylic acids, a hydroxyl acid, a phosphoric acid, or a combination of two or more thereof. 8 . The soil wetting composition of claim 1 , wherein the sugar is selected from lactose, maltose, maltodextrin, galactose, xylose, or a combination of two or more thereof. 9 . The soil wetting composition of claim 1 , wherein the carrier resin is selected from a urea formaldehyde resin. 10 . The soil wetting composition of claim 1 , wherein the siloxane alkoxylate (a) is present in amount of from about 5 wt. % to about 60 wt. %; the polymeric dispersant (b) is present in an amount of from about 1 wt. % to about 10 wt. %; the pH adjuster (c) is present in an amount of from about 0.1 wt. % to about 5 wt. %; the sugar (d) is present in an amount of from about 5 wt. % to about 15 wt. %; and the carrier resin (e) is present in an amount of from about 20 wt. % to about 50 wt. %, and the wt. % is based on the total weight of the soil wetting composition. 11 . A soil composition comprising the soil wetting agent of claim 1 . 12 . An agrochemical composition comprising the soil wetting agent of claim 1 . 13 . The agrochemical composition of claim 12 , comprising a fertilizer. 14 . A method of treating an agricultural area by applying the soil wetting agent of claim 1 , to an area of the agricultural area. 15 . The method of claim 14 comprising applying water to the agricultural area. 16 . The method of claim 15 , wherein from about 10% to about 70% less water is applied to the agricultural area than is required in the absence of the soil wetting agent. 17 . A method of treating an agricultural area by applying the agrochemical composition of claim 12 or 13 to an area of the agricultural area. 18 . The method of claim 17 comprising applying water to the agricultural area. 19 . The method of claim 18 , wherein from about 10% to about 70% less water is applied to the agricultural area than is required in the absence of the soil wetting agent.
